Another Real Estate Agent from TRNC Arrested at Larnaca Airport
Another real estate agent from the TRNC has been arrested at Larnaca Airport. The 49-year-old woman is suspected of advertising and “facilitating the sale of property in the north of the island on Greek-Cypriot lands.”
According to Greek media reports, the suspect, a citizen of an EU country, was detained last Sunday around noon upon her arrival at Larnaca Airport. Earlier, the police had issued a warrant for her arrest.
It is noted that the detained woman became the second real estate agent arrested on these charges. Previously, a warrant was issued for the arrest of a German citizen residing in the TRNC. The man was supposed to appear before the police of the Republic of Cyprus to give testimony but ignored the summons.
Initially, it was expected that the arrested German would testify at the end of June.
However, according to Turkish media reports, the suspect filed a request through his lawyer not to testify to the Greek-Cypriot police, citing illness. However, the police rejected his request, insisting on his appearance.
Recall that earlier reports indicated that Turkish Cypriot leader Ersin Tatar had drawn attention to the situation involving the detention of foreigners involved in real estate sales in the TRNC. Tatar had met with the personal representative of the UN Secretary-General in Cyprus, Maria Angela Holguín Cuellar, and the head of the UN Peacekeeping Force in Cyprus, Colin Stewart.
The head of Northern Cyprus described this situation, which “has no place in the legal field,” as “unacceptable.”
